A desk is no substitute for heavy speaker stands. I would only keep that budget if you can get them off the desk (beyond the desk). Find where the speakers sound best in the room off the desk on good stands and only then move your desk to where the best sound is. When the speakers are firing toward you with a desk in between, you might also consider treating the desk to dampen reflections.
